feritas.

wildness, barbaric/savage/uncultivated state; savagery, ferocity; brutality;

Where this word comes from

Etymology tree Latin ferus Proto-Indo-European *-teh₂ Proto-Indo-European *-ts Proto-Indo-European *-teh₂ts Proto-Italic *-tāts Latin -tās Latin feritās From ferus (“savage”) + -tās.
